Building foundation repair services focus on assessing and restoring the stability of a property's foundation. These services typically involve diagnosing issues such as cracks, settling, or uneven floors that indicate underlying structural problems. Repair methods may include underpinning, pier installation, mudjacking, or foundation wall stabilization, all aimed at restoring the integrity of the foundation and preventing further damage. The goal is to ensure a safe, level, and durable base for the entire structure.
Foundation problems often stem from soil movement, moisture issues, poor construction, or aging materials, which can lead to significant structural concerns if left unaddressed. Common signs of foundation trouble include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that don’t close properly, or uneven flooring.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500 depending on the extent of the damage and repair methods used. Minor repairs, such as crack filling, may cost around $1,000 to $3,000, while more ext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Costs vary based on the specific needs of each property.
Factors Influencing Costs - The size and type of foundation, soil conditions, and the severity of issues all impact repair costs. For example, a small crack in a basement wall might be less expensive to fix than a large settlement requiring extensive underpinning.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ual assessments.
Average Cost Range - On average, homeowners in Wilson County, TN, might expect to pay between $3,000 and $6,000 for typical foundation repair projects. Larger or more complex repairs can go beyond this range, especially if additional structural work is needed. Accurate quotes depend on a thorough inspection by local specialists.

What are common signs that a building foundation need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ps between walls and ceilings.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my property? Some level of disruption may occur, such as noise or minor construction activity, but experienced local contractors aim to minimize inconvenience during repairs.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services may include underpinning, pier and beam repair, slabjacking, or crack sealing, depending on the foundation's condition and type.
